While searching for content on such platforms is common, it carries significant risks and legal implications. Below is a comprehensive look at the series, why it's popular, and the safer, legal alternatives for watching it. What is the Breathe TV Series?

Breathe is a gritty Indian crime thriller that debuted in 2018 as one of Amazon Prime Video's first major Indian originals. The show explores the lengths a parent will go to for their child through a high-stakes "cat and mouse" game.

Season 1: Stars R. Madhavan as Danny Mascarenhas, a desperate father who begins systematically killing organ donors to move his dying son up the transplant list. He is pursued by Kabir Sawant (Amit Sadh), a brilliant but troubled police officer.

Season 2 (Breathe: Into the Shadows): Features Abhishek Bachchan as a psychiatrist whose daughter is kidnapped by a mysterious masked man. This sequel continues the theme of moral dilemmas and desperate parenthood. Why People Search for "TamilRockers TF"

TamilRockers is a bootleg recording network known for distributing pirated copies of movies and web series. The ".tf" suffix is one of many mirror domains (along with .ws, .be, etc.) used to bypass government bans and ISP blocks.

The Mechanics of the Domain: "www tamilrockers tf"

The core of the subject lies in the domain "tamilrockers.tf." TamilRockers is perhaps the most infamous name in the Indian internet piracy sphere. Originally starting as a torrent tracker for Tamil films, it evolved into a colossal platform distributing movies and web series from Bollywood, Tollywood, Kollywood, and Hollywood, often within hours of their official release.

The extension ".tf" is a critical detail here. It represents the country code top-level domain (ccTLD) for the French Southern and Antarctic Lands. However, in the world of piracy, the actual geography is irrelevant; the extension is chosen for its lenient registration policies and the difficulty copyright holders face when trying to enforce takedowns through standard legal channels.

Piracy websites like TamilRockers operate on a game of "domain whack-a-mole." When authorities block a domain (such as tamilrockers.com, .in, .net, or .org), the administrators simply migrate the database to a new extension. The use of ".tf" suggests a period where the primary domains were blocked by Indian Internet Service Providers (ISPs) under court orders. Users searching for "www tamilrockers tf" are effectively trying to bypass these government-imposed blocks to find the current live mirror of the site.

The Technical Evolution: From Torrents to Telegram

The search for a specific URL like "tamilrockers tf" also highlights a shift in how piracy is consumed. In the early days of file sharing, users relied on Peer-to-Peer (P2P) protocols via torrent clients. This required a certain level of technical literacy—finding the torrent file, loading it into a client, and managing seeds and peers.

Today, the landscape has shifted toward direct download links (DDL) and cloud-based sharing. A search for a TamilRockers domain often leads not just to a torrent file, but to direct links on file-hosting services or, increasingly, to Telegram channels. Breathe, being a web series, is particularly susceptible to this form of distribution. Unlike massive video files of 4K movies, episodes of web series are smaller and easier to upload and download quickly. Piracy groups often rip the stream from Amazon Prime, strip the Digital Rights Management (DRM), and re-encode the file for easy distribution. The "www tamilrockers tf" search is a user’s entry point into this underground supply chain.

The Government’s Response

The Indian government and film industry bodies have waged a long war against TamilRockers. Under the Information Technology Act, courts frequently order ISPs to block access to these sites. This is precisely why the ".tf" domain exists in the user's query—it is a testament to the partial success of these blocks. The user cannot access the main site, so they seek a proxy or a new domain.

However, technical blocks are often porous. Tech-savvy users utilize Virtual Private Networks (VPNs) to mask their IP addresses, rendering geographical blocks useless. The search for "www tamilrockers tf breathe" encapsulates this cat-and-mouse chase: the industry creates content (Breathe), the government blocks access, and the piracy ecosystem mutates (moving to .tf domains) to survive.

The History of TamilRockers

TamilRockers was founded in 2011 by a group of individuals who aimed to provide a platform for users to download and share Tamil movies, music, and other content. Initially, the website focused on catering to the Tamil-speaking audience, but over time, it expanded its scope to include content from other languages, including Telugu, Malayalam, and Kannada.
